Score a goal with Flower City Union tickets. The Flower City Union is an American Professional Soccer team that is located in the heart of Rochester, N.Y. They are a part of the National Independent Soccer Association (NISA), which is part of the third tier of the United States Soccer system. They will play against other stellar squads such as the California United Strikers FC, AC Syracuse Pulse and the Maryland Bobcats FC to name just three. They play their home games at the Marina Auto Stadium which has a capacity of over 13,000 screaming fans.

The Flower City Union was established after it was announced that the USL's Rochester Rhinos were going to go on hiatus in the 2018 season, leaving the team's stadium vacant. After two years, NISA approved the group's expansion application submitted by David Weaver in the winter of 2020. In the spring of 2021, it was unveiled the team's primary color would be the lilac in honor of the signature flower of Rochester. Root for your home team with Flower City Union tickets.
